The first time I bought a diamond ring I went to a jewelry store. The store was family owned and had multiple locations in my area. I recognized their brand and had a referral that got me a sit down with one of the owners. He talked me thru the 4 C's and showed me multiple diamonds in my price range.
To this day I am amazed that forking over so much cash for a cut and polished rock could have been so pleasurable. I felt that I was educated, shown suitable options and never hard sold.
Call me superstitious, an introvert or maybe just a touch more savvy than before but this time I decided not to reach out to the boss man for a sales call. Instead I started my own search online.
In the end for me, the value and flexibility of online shopping edges out the brick and mortar retail experience. In fact many online retailers have in person showrooms and agreements with brick and mortar affiliates, so to call them "online only" is not really correct.

James Allen and Blue Nile: Great Prices, No Hassle Returns, 24/7 Support:
Most people have heard of James Allen and Blue Nile. They make finding and purchasing your diamond easy. In fact they go beyond that. Should you have any problem, concern or change in plans they make it easy to facilitate a return as well. They have a 30 day no hassle policy so if you want to hold it in your hand to be sure, go ahead and order. Talk, text or email an advisor 24/7 via the website so you can get answers anytime. If you are anything like me, it is sometimes the middle of the night when you have time to focus so it's nice to be able to reach someone about a specific diamond regardless of the hour. James Allen and Blue Nile's prices are tough to beat. They have arrangements with affiliates so that you can go to a physical location for cleanings or a repair. Traditional Brick and Mortar stores just can't compete. If you have been considering a lab created diamond, they have those too.
